Atletico Madrid concede late as they are held to a 1-1 draw at Mallorca in La Liga.

Atletico Madrid have failed to win their first La Liga match of 2013 as they conceded late in a 1-1 draw at Mallorca.

The best chance of a goalless first half fell for Diego Costa, who saw his effort pushed away by Mallorca goalkeeper Dudu Aouate.

Atletico came within inches of taking the lead just before the hour as Raul Garcia's header crashed off the woodwork.

However, the midfielder made no mistake in the 72nd minute when he converted the rebound after Costa's initial shot had been saved.

The visitors looked on course for the three points before substitute Kevin lashed in a powerful drive on the angle with three minutes left to play to bring the sides level.

Giovani dos Santos almost snatched the win for Atletico in injury time, only for his free kick to hit the post.
